How To Create an Outdoor Living Space You’ll Love On a Budget

The benefits of being outdoors are many. According to science, time spent in the great outdoors comes with many known advantages — such as an improved immune system, increased energy, and a mood boost — and several other, lesser-known perks — such as increased creativity and restored focus. Given all the outdoors can do for you, it makes sense to want to spend as much time outside as possible. The best, most affordable, and most practical way to do so is to head outside into your own backyard.

The problem with most peoples’ backyards is that they lack focus and all the trappings of a comfortable living space. It’s hard to want to spend time in a barren yard in which you cannot get comfortable and that holds no real appeal to you. The good news is that you can easily change that and create a space you will love with a few quick and affordable fixes.

Divide Your Yard Into “Zones”

Many people don’t know what to do with their yards simply because most yards are “too much.” While a lot of empty space is essentially a blank canvas, for many people, a blank canvas presents an overwhelming number of possibilities. The best way to manage those possibilities is to break the yard up into different “zones,” or uses.

For instance, you may want a flower garden, a vegetable garden, an outdoor kitchen, a lounge area, and a firepit. When faced with the yard as a whole, though, you may struggle to see how all your wants can come together in one cohesive design. Once you begin to segment the yard, however, it will become easier to see how you can make space for each element and, more importantly, how each will complement the other.

Create Shade

Once you establish zones, decide which one matters most to you and begin building it out. If creating a comfortable living space tops your list, start by creating a shaded patio area. You can create a nice-looking cabana on a budget with some 2x4s, cement, and fabric. Use pea gravel, brick, or even just a large rug to establish the floor. String lights, hedges, potted plants, and affordable outdoor furniture offer the perfect finishing touches.

Invest In Quality But Affordable Furniture

Speaking of affordable furniture … You may be hard-pressed to spend time outdoors if you don’t have anywhere to sit, relax, and socialize. While you should work with your budget in mind, you don’t want to sacrifice comfort to merely save a few bucks. Look for durable yet comfortable seating, such as outdoor restaurant chairs; sturdy side and dining tables; and practical and multifunctional storage units. By investing in multipurpose furniture designed to last for years, you can feel justified in spending a little more money on quality pieces.

Use Native Plants in Your Landscaping

Native plants require minimal upkeep and come back year after year. This guarantees that you will enjoy a beautiful landscape year after year and without having to invest additional money after the first season.

Creating a beautiful backyard you will want to spend time in may seem like a daunting task, but with the above advice, it’s actually relatively easy and inexpensive. Get started by zoning out your yard and building a seating space today.
